Energy Transfer LP is considering the potential sale of its 33% stake in the Rover Pipeline, which carries gas from the Appalachian Basin to customers across the Midwest, according to an unnamed source as reported by Bloomberg.

Energy Transfer has hired an advisor to pursue a potential sale of its operated interest in the Rover pipeline, which could sell for as much as $2.5 billion.

At this time, no decision has been made and the company could choose not to sell.
